Being a comedian is the hardest thing anyone can do. As such, those who achieve even a modicum of success in this selfless, humanitarian, dangerous career are rightly held up as the best of us. True heroes. In this series David Reed will interview some of comedy's most available exponents and ask them "Who are you under all that skin?", "When did comedy first bite you?" and "What's the microphone for?" as he delves deeper than anyone has ever delved inside the comedian.

Inside The Comedy
David Reed (Penny Dreadfuls, Film Fandango) 'interviews' comedians about the unbelievably true highs and lows of their career. Very funny, a nice counterpoint to the insightful but terribly earnest comedy interview podcast format.
